Evening,

I am in need of some information on the 1.5 tsport engines and both of the 1.3's (phase 1 and 2).

Are the 1.5 tsport and 1.3 phase 2 cylinder blocks the same units?

Also, does anyone know what pre-load and ramp angles are used in the trd lsd units?

Many thanks.

Hello and welcome to the Yaris club.

I'm pretty sure the 1.3 and 1.5 are the same engines, the 1.5 just being a bored out 1.3 with 20bhp more at 106bhp They do look identical under the bonnet though.

Can't help with the other question sorry.

Hi, looking from the information on the links, the 1.3 is the same bore size as the 1.5 but the stroke is longer on the crank.
